.Hopefully the comment was meant more towards "we train differently now, so some of these specialties aren't as needed"
In a sense yes. Mostly it was about the specialties being redundant. There's zero reason the Army can't produce it's own JTACs and highly qualified medics and, in fact, they do exactly that. The amount of money it takes to train a CCT or PJ whom will never actually operate in his own branch of service but rather support others would be better spent elsewhere. And the army would produce better and more qualified combat controllers as it is.

As it stands now the Air Force spends millions of dollars and years of valuable time to create either a medic or JTAC that also has at least some ground combat skills. Well, we have an entire army(literally) of qualified medics and ground combat soldiers that could easily be taught how to control close air support. It's really not all that difficult.

Two other things...

1. PJ's haven't actually done their stated mission in God know's how long. Pretty sure the Marines are the go to guys for personnel recovery if history is any guide. Just look at Scott O'Grady and the downing of the F-15E in Libya. So we have PJ's acting as an overfunded over supplied support unit who send medics to SOF teams just so they'll have something to do. News flash...All the SOF units already have their own medical personnel.

2. CAS is going to go the way of the dodo bird in the near future with the exception of very rare circumstances. Surface to Surface fires have just become too good. They're just as accurate, far more reliable, far cheaper, the logistics train on them is exponentially smaller and they are more responsive. And it only gets better by the day. Not to mention it's much easier to coordinate surface fires than it is to coordinate and deconflict CAS.
